Modern agriculture demands a strong scientific and technical foundation. At St. Cyprian High School, the curriculum is designed to provide students with a comprehensive understanding of the biological, chemical, and environmental principles that govern successful farming. Students delve into soil science, plant genetics, animal husbandry, and basic ecology.
However, the school recognizes that knowledge is most impactful when it is relevant to real-world challenges. Research suggests that for many young people, schooling is often valued more as a path to formal employment than for acquiring practical skills. St. Cyprian counters this by linking classroom instructions to immediate, tangible applications. For example, students have undertaken projects on creating bio-pesticides as a sustainable solution to chemical alternatives, a project that blends biology, chemistry, and environmental awareness. This contextual learning approach ensures that the “why” behind the “how” is firmly understood, making the knowledge stick.
The true strength of St. Cyprian High School’s approach lies in its emphasis on practical skills development. The school utilizes demonstration farms and school gardens as living laboratories, moving beyond the theoretical constraints often found in other institutions.
The use of practical demonstrations is essential for improving students’ farming skills. In the school garden, students acquire skills in critical areas such as garden planning, setting up and managing nursery beds, and transplanting seedlings. These activities ensure students gain valuable, real-life competencies that are immediately transferable to their own ventures or the job market.
 The curriculum fosters an environment where students apply their knowledge to solve real-world agricultural problems. By engaging in hands-on projects and field trips, students gain experience in diagnosing issues, managing resources, and adapting to variable conditions—key skills for the unpredictable nature of farming.

While some challenges like funding for garden activities and scheduling exist, the school’s commitment to using the garden as a teaching resource is clear. By prioritizing time for these practical outdoor activities, St. Cyprian helps students nurture a love of agriculture and the environment, ensuring a lasting connection to the field.
